Circana: U.S. camera sales a bright spot over Black Friday

U.S. sales of consumer technology products were generally lackluster over Black Friday Week and Cyber Week when compared to last year, in line with broader discretionary general merchandise spending trends, according to industry research firm Circana (formerly NPD). Labpano launches 360-degree 8K panoramic camera, Pilot One

Labpano (formerly Pisofttech) launched a new generation 360-degree panoramic camera, Pilot One. It supports 8K VR photography, recording, and  8K live streaming. Pilot One comes with three innovations in one camera:  Swiftbird, a cloud-based live streaming solution, Pilot Open System, allowing developers to build their own apps, and Pilot Tour, a realtime V-SLAM positioning solution for precisely-positioned virtual tours. Hardware in crisis: Can camera companies compete?

The hardgoods part of the photo industry has always been highly competitive and price sensitive. Accessory sales prop up profit margins, as dealers rely on photo printing, lenses, bags, tripods, filters and other add-ons to build comfortable margins.
